Output 2ea0d36c26a53ebf4bd937ad02e873d97fa56bd1c96436422c23ff573a6abef7:21

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32a4bd5b5bd5bb7a1112be31a8fc1a2b509e50e OP_EQUAL
address
A8mcHXAiPWdfQ94v3XXSZLKGyrxKKthpKk
transaction
2ea0d36c26a53ebf4bd937ad02e873d97fa56bd1c96436422c23ff573a6abef7